Cara Mengunduh & Menginstal MongoDB on Windows dan Awan
Pemasang untuk MongoDB tersedia dalam format 32-bit dan 64-bit. Penginstal 32-bit bagus untuk lingkungan pengembangan dan pengujian. Namun untuk lingkungan produksi, Anda harus menggunakan penginstal 64-bit. Jika tidak, Anda dapat dibatasi pada jumlah data yang dapat disimpan di dalamnya MongoDB.
Dianjurkan untuk selalu menggunakan rilis stabil untuk lingkungan produksi.
Cara Mengunduh & Menginstal MongoDB on Windows
Langkah-langkah berikut dapat digunakan untuk mengunduh dan menginstal MongoDB on Windows 10
Langkah 1) Unduh MongoDB Community Server
Pergi ke link dan Unduh MongoDB Server Komunitas. Kami akan menginstal versi 64-bit untuk Windows.
Langkah 2) Klik pada Pengaturan
Setelah pengunduhan selesai, buka file msi. Klik Berikutnya di layar permulaan
Langkah 3) Terima Perjanjian Lisensi Pengguna Akhir
- Terima Perjanjian Lisensi Pengguna Akhir
- Klik Berikutnya
Langkah 4) Klik pada tombol "lengkap".
Klik tombol “lengkap” untuk menginstal semua komponen. Opsi kustom dapat digunakan untuk menginstal komponen selektif atau jika Anda ingin mengubah lokasi instalasi.
Langkah 5) Layanan Konfigurasi
- Pilih "Jalankan layanan sebagai pengguna Layanan Jaringan". catat direktori data, kita akan membutuhkannya nanti.
- Klik Berikutnya
Langkah 6) Mulai proses instalasi
Klik tombol Instal untuk memulai instalasi.
Langkah 7) Klik Berikutnya setelah selesai
Instalasi dimulai. Klik Berikutnya setelah selesai
Langkah 8) Klik pada tombol Selesai
Langkah terakhir, Setelah instalasi selesai, Klik tombol Selesai
Hello Dunia MongoDB: JavaPengemudi Skrip
Driver masuk MongoDB digunakan untuk konektivitas antara aplikasi klien dan database. Misalnya, jika Anda punya Java program dan mengharuskannya untuk terhubung MongoDB maka Anda perlu mengunduh dan mengintegrasikannya Java driver sehingga program dapat bekerja dengan MongoDB database.
Sopir untuk JavaNaskah keluar dari kotak. MongoDB shell yang digunakan untuk bekerja MongoDB database sebenarnya adalah shell javascript. Untuk mengaksesnya
Langkah 1) Pergi ke ” C:\Program Files\MongoDB\Server\4.0\bin” dan klik dua kali pada mongo.exe. Atau, Anda juga dapat mengklik MongoDB barang desktop
Langkah 2) Masukkan program berikut ke dalam shell
var myMessage='Hello World'; printjson(myMessage);
Penjelasan Kode:
- Kami hanya mendeklarasikan secara sederhana Javascript variabel untuk menyimpan string yang disebut 'Halo Dunia.'
- Kami menggunakan metode printjson untuk mencetak variabel ke layar.
Install Python sopir
Langkah 1) Memastikan Python diinstal pada sistem
Langkah 2) Instal driver terkait mongo dengan mengeluarkan perintah di bawah ini
pip install pymongo
Instal Driver Ruby
Langkah 1) Pastikan Ruby terinstal di sistem
Langkah 2) Pastikan permata diperbarui dengan mengeluarkan perintah
gem update -system
Langkah 3) Instal driver terkait mongo dengan mengeluarkan perintah di bawah ini
gem install mong
Install MongoDB Compass- MongoDB Alat Manajemen
Ada alat di pasar yang tersedia untuk dikelola MongoDB. Salah satu alat non-komersial tersebut adalah MongoDB Compass.
Beberapa fitur Kompas diberikan di bawah ini:
- Kekuatan penuh Mongoshell
- Banyak cangkang
- Hasil ganda
Langkah 1) Pergi ke link dan klik unduh
Langkah 2) Masukkan detail di popup dan klik kirim
Langkah 3) Double klik pada file yang diunduh
Langkah 4) Instalasi akan dimulai secara otomatis
Langkah 5) Kompas akan diluncurkan dengan layar Selamat Datang
Langkah 6) Pertahankan pengaturan privasi sebagai default dan Klik “Mulai Menggunakan Kompas”
Langkah 7) Anda akan melihat layar beranda dengan daftar database saat ini.
MongoDB Konfigurasi, Impor, dan Ekspor
Sebelum memulai MongoDB server, aspek kunci pertama adalah mengkonfigurasi direktori data tempat semua MongoDB data akan disimpan. Hal ini dapat dilakukan dengan cara berikut
Perintah di atas 'md \data\db' membuat direktori bernama \data\db di lokasi Anda saat ini.
MongoDB akan secara otomatis membuat database di lokasi ini, karena ini adalah lokasi defaultnya MongoDB untuk menyimpan informasinya. Kami hanya memastikan direktori tersebut ada, sehingga MongoDB dapat menemukannya ketika dimulai.
Impor data ke MongoDB dilakukan dengan menggunakan perintah “mongoimport”. Contoh berikut menunjukkan bagaimana hal ini dapat dilakukan.
Langkah 1) Buat file CSV bernama data.csv dan masukkan data berikut di dalamnya
Employeeid, Nama Karyawan
- Guru99
- Mohan
- Smith
Jadi pada contoh di atas, kita berasumsi kita ingin mengimpor 3 dokumen ke dalam kumpulan yang disebut data. Baris pertama disebut baris header yang akan menjadi nama Field dari koleksi tersebut.
Langkah 2) Keluarkan perintah impor mongo
Penjelasan Kode:
- Kami menentukan opsi db untuk mengatakan ke database mana data harus diimpor
- Opsi type adalah untuk menentukan bahwa kita sedang mengimpor file csv
- Ingatlah bahwa baris pertama disebut baris header yang akan menjadi nama Field dari koleksi, oleh karena itu kita menentukan opsi –headerline. Dan kemudian kami menentukan file data.csv kami.
Keluaran
Outputnya dengan jelas menunjukkan bahwa 3 dokumen telah diimpor MongoDB.
Mengekspor MongoDB dilakukan dengan menggunakan perintah mongoexport
Penjelasan Kode:
- Kami menentukan opsi db untuk mengatakan dari database mana data harus diekspor.
- Kami menentukan opsi koleksi untuk menentukan koleksi mana yang akan digunakan
- Opsi ketiga adalah menentukan bahwa kita ingin mengekspor ke file csv
- Yang keempat adalah menentukan bidang koleksi mana yang harus diekspor.
- Opsi –out menentukan nama file csv tujuan ekspor data.
Keluaran
Outputnya dengan jelas menunjukkan bahwa 3 catatan diekspor MongoDB.
Mengkonfigurasi MongoDB server dengan file konfigurasi
Seseorang dapat mengonfigurasi instance server mongod untuk memulai dengan file konfigurasi. File konfigurasi berisi pengaturan yang setara dengan opsi baris perintah mongod.
Misalnya, Anda ingin MongoDB untuk menyimpan semua informasi loggingnya ke lokasi khusus, lalu ikuti langkah-langkah di bawah ini
Langkah 1) Buat file bernama, “mongod.conf” dan simpan informasi di bawah ini ke dalam file
- Baris pertama file menentukan bahwa kita ingin menambahkan konfigurasi untuk file log sistem, di situlah informasi tentang apa yang dilakukan server dalam file log khusus.
- Opsi kedua adalah menyebutkan bahwa lokasinya adalah file.
- Ini menyebutkan lokasi file log
- logAppend: “true” berarti memastikan bahwa informasi log terus ditambahkan ke file log. Jika Anda memasukkan nilai sebagai "false", maka file tersebut akan dihapus dan dibuat baru setiap kali server dimulai kembali.
Langkah 2) Mulai proses server mongod dan tentukan file konfigurasi yang dibuat di atas sebagai parameter. Tangkapan layar tentang bagaimana hal ini dapat dilakukan ditunjukkan di bawah
Setelah perintah di atas dijalankan, proses server akan mulai menggunakan file konfigurasi ini, dan jika Anda membuka /etc. direktori di sistem Anda, Anda akan melihat file mongod.log dibuat.
Cuplikan di bawah ini menunjukkan contoh tampilan file log.
Cara Install MongoDB di Cloud (AWS, Google, Azure)
Anda tidak perlu menginstal MongoDB server dan mengkonfigurasinya. Anda dapat menerapkan MongoDB Server Atlas di cloud pada platform seperti AWS, Google Cloud, Azure dan terhubung ke instance menggunakan klien. Di bawah ini adalah langkah-langkah detailnya
Langkah 1) Pergi ke link
- Masukkan Detail Pribadi
- Setuju dengan persyaratan
- Klik tombol “Memulai Gratis”
Langkah 2) Klik “Bangun cluster pertama saya”
Langkah 3) Anda dapat memilih di antaranya AWS, Google Cloud, Azure sebagai penyedia cloud Anda. Dalam tutorial ini, kita akan menggunakan AWS yang disetel sebagai default. Jangan membuat perubahan lain pada halaman dan klik “Buat Cluster. "
Langkah 4) Cluster pembuatan memerlukan waktu:
Langkah 5) Setelah beberapa waktu Anda akan melihatnya
Langkah 6) Klik Keamanan > Tambahkan pengguna baru
Langkah 7) Di layar berikutnya,
- Masukkan kredensial pengguna
- Tetapkan hak istimewa
- Klik tombol Tambah Pengguna
Langkah 8) Di dasbor, klik tombol sambungkan
- Masukkan koneksi IP Anda ke daftar putih
- Pilih metode koneksi
Langkah 9) Pilih metode koneksi pilihan Anda untuk dihubungkan MongoDB Server